Mayor: Do we want European future? Then we have to keep constructing, not destroying
“We all bear responsibility for ongoing events; we must recognise what might societal conflict and division lead to,” Tbilisi Mayor Kakha Kaladze stated in a Sunday Facebook video address.
According to Kakha Kaladze, “the confrontation and the attempt to split the society can have the hardest consequences.”
“The confrontation must cease; the country faces the greatest problems; consider what is going on in the globe. I believe that we should work together to tackle these difficulties.
We must answer the basic question: ‘Do we want a European future? Then we have to keep constructing, not destroying’,” stated Kakha Kaladze.
